About
National Express is the UK’s leading long-distance coach company, operating over 550 services per day and serving more than 900 destinations nationwide. It also runs frequent services to major UK airports — including Heathrow, Gatwick, Stansted, Luton, and Bristol — 24 hours a day. All National Express coaches are air-conditioned and offer free Wi-Fi and onboard entertainment. Most vehicles are equipped with seat belts and power outlets at every seat, allowing you to charge your phone or laptop during your journey. Ticket options include Restricted Fare, Standard Fare, and Fully Flexible Fare, with the latter providing maximum flexibility for cancellations or changes.

Complete guide to Newmarket

Things to do in Newmarket

Discover the best of Newmarket — top attractions, local food, transport tips, budget advice, and currency essentials. Plan your perfect Newmarket trip today.

  • Must visit

National Horseracing Museum

Modern museum of horseracing with galleries, retired racehorses and interactive displays. Essential for understanding Newmarket’s identity.

  • Recommended

Packard Galleries

Art gallery within Palace House presenting changing exhibitions in an elegant historic setting connected to Newmarket’s royal past.

  • Recommended

Palace House

Historic royal residence integrated into the horseracing museum site. Displays reveal court life and Newmarket’s early racing history.

Pound sterling (£)

Generally moderate for the UK: dining and hotels are lower than London, while rail fares and event weekends can raise costs.

Average meal costs

Budget
£8-15 for fast food or a simple meal.
Mid-range
£18-30 per person for a restaurant meal.
Fine dining
£50+ per person for upscale dining.
Coffee
£3-4 for a cappuccino.

Tipping culture

Tipping is optional. In restaurants, 10-12.5% is usual if service is not included. Round up for taxis and small café bills only if service was good.
